Typical day You are also at the office during the first hour after lunch, when more mothers come by to drop off their kids or attend a workshop. Your presence is important: it makes it easier for them to find you. Then, you will make one or two visits to ensure a follow up. This is more a social task and people usualy tell you what keeps them busy and how they are doing without you asking questions. These visits are your chance to build bridges with the families: you show interest in what people are doing and you give them a chance to talk about any problem. Administration is done at the volunteers' house in the morning or evening. During the weeks when SKIP's entrepreneurs are making school uniforms, shoes and Christmas breads, you are also in charge of coordinating the production and buying materials. This means going regularly to the markets and running around to solve problems that always pop up. References If you are interested in volunteering for our economic
